Taoiseach's Message on Budget 2014

In a video message released this morning, Taoiseach Enda Kenny reaffirmed his expectation that Ireland will exit its bailout programme this December.

Emphasising the pro jobs elements of the budget, the Taoiseach said:

The budget was designed to build on the 3,000 private sector jobs being created every month.

We also introduced a new €500m jobs package with 25 new tax measures to accelerate job creation over the next year.

Measures such as maintaining the 9% VAT rate for the tourism sector which has already created 15,000 new jobs since its introduction.

The Taoiseach added:

I want to thank those hard working families and all the people of Ireland for their sacrifices over the years. Those sacrifices are now paying off.

We are now on course to move into a brighter future for Ireland and for the next generation.
